svn commit: r530005 - head/misc/broot

Tobias Kortkamp tobik at FreeBSD.org
Tue Mar 31 19:13:39 UTC 2020


Author: tobik
Date: Tue Mar 31 19:13:28 2020
New Revision: 530005
URL: https://svnweb.freebsd.org/changeset/ports/530005

Log:
  misc/broot: Update to 0.13.5b
  
  - Install new manual
  - Add missing libgit2 dependency
  
  Changes:	https://github.com/Canop/broot/releases/tag/v0.13.5b
  PR:		245173
  Submitted by:	Lewis Cook <vulcan at wired.sh> (maintainer)

Modified:
  head/misc/broot/Makefile
  head/misc/broot/distinfo

Modified: head/misc/broot/Makefile
==============================================================================
--- head/misc/broot/Makefile	Tue Mar 31 19:01:48 2020	(r530004)
+++ head/misc/broot/Makefile	Tue Mar 31 19:13:28 2020	(r530005)
@@ -1,8 +1,8 @@
 # $FreeBSD$
 
 PORTNAME=	broot
+PORTVERSION=	0.13.5b
 DISTVERSIONPREFIX=	v
-DISTVERSION=	0.13.4
 CATEGORIES=	misc
 
 MAINTAINER=	vulcan at wired.sh
@@ -11,6 +11,7 @@ COMMENT=	Quick and easy new way to see and navigate di
 LICENSE=	MIT
 LICENSE_FILE=	${WRKSRC}/LICENSE
 
+LIB_DEPENDS=	libgit2.so:devel/libgit2
 RUN_DEPENDS=	git:devel/git
 
 USES=		cargo
@@ -93,7 +94,7 @@ CARGO_CRATES=	aho-corasick-0.7.6 \
 		num-integer-0.1.41 \
 		num-traits-0.2.8 \
 		num_cpus-1.11.1 \
-		open-1.3.2 \
+		open-1.4.0 \
 		parking_lot-0.10.0 \
 		parking_lot_core-0.7.0 \
 		pathdiff-0.1.0 \
@@ -163,13 +164,20 @@ CARGO_CRATES=	aho-corasick-0.7.6 \
 		ws2_32-sys-0.2.1
 
 SUB_FILES=	pkg-message
-PLIST_FILES=	bin/${PORTNAME}
+PLIST_FILES=	bin/${PORTNAME} \
+		man/man1/${PORTNAME}.1.gz
 PORTDOCS=	CHANGELOG.md README.md
 
 OPTIONS_DEFINE=	DOCS
 
+pre-build:
+	@${MV} ${WRKSRC}/man/page ${WRKSRC}/man/${PORTNAME}.1
+	@${REINPLACE_CMD} -e 's|#version|${PORTVERSION}|g' \
+		-e "s|#date|$$(date +'%Y\/%m\/%d')|g" ${WRKSRC}/man/${PORTNAME}.1
+
 post-install:
 	${STRIP_CMD} ${STAGEDIR}${PREFIX}/bin/${PORTNAME}
+	${INSTALL_MAN} ${WRKSRC}/man/${PORTNAME}.1 ${STAGEDIR}${MAN1PREFIX}/man/man1
 
 post-install-DOCS-on:
 	@${MKDIR} ${STAGEDIR}${DOCSDIR}

Modified: head/misc/broot/distinfo
==============================================================================
--- head/misc/broot/distinfo	Tue Mar 31 19:01:48 2020	(r530004)
+++ head/misc/broot/distinfo	Tue Mar 31 19:13:28 2020	(r530005)
@@ -1,4 +1,4 @@
-TIMESTAMP = 1584205026
+TIMESTAMP = 1585662609
 SHA256 (rust/crates/aho-corasick-0.7.6.tar.gz) = 58fb5e95d83b38284460a5fda7d6470aa0b8844d283a0b614b8535e880800d2d
 SIZE (rust/crates/aho-corasick-0.7.6.tar.gz) = 108953
 SHA256 (rust/crates/ansi_term-0.11.0.tar.gz) = ee49baf6cb617b853aa8d93bf420db2383fab46d314482ca2803b40d5fde979b
@@ -151,8 +151,8 @@ SHA256 (rust/crates/num-traits-0.2.8.tar.gz) = 6ba9a42
 SIZE (rust/crates/num-traits-0.2.8.tar.gz) = 39965
 SHA256 (rust/crates/num_cpus-1.11.1.tar.gz) = 76dac5ed2a876980778b8b85f75a71b6cbf0db0b1232ee12f826bccb00d09d72
 SIZE (rust/crates/num_cpus-1.11.1.tar.gz) = 11798
-SHA256 (rust/crates/open-1.3.2.tar.gz) = 94b424e1086328b0df10235c6ff47be63708071881bead9e76997d9291c0134b
-SIZE (rust/crates/open-1.3.2.tar.gz) = 4447
+SHA256 (rust/crates/open-1.4.0.tar.gz) = 7c283bf0114efea9e42f1a60edea9859e8c47528eae09d01df4b29c1e489cc48
+SIZE (rust/crates/open-1.4.0.tar.gz) = 5084
 SHA256 (rust/crates/parking_lot-0.10.0.tar.gz) = 92e98c49ab0b7ce5b222f2cc9193fc4efe11c6d0bd4f648e374684a6857b1cfc
 SIZE (rust/crates/parking_lot-0.10.0.tar.gz) = 37899
 SHA256 (rust/crates/parking_lot_core-0.7.0.tar.gz) = 7582838484df45743c8434fbff785e8edf260c28748353d44bc0da32e0ceabf1
@@ -287,5 +287,5 @@ SHA256 (rust/crates/winapi-x86_64-pc-windows-gnu-0.4.0
 SIZE (rust/crates/winapi-x86_64-pc-windows-gnu-0.4.0.tar.gz) = 2947998
 SHA256 (rust/crates/ws2_32-sys-0.2.1.tar.gz) = d59cefebd0c892fa2dd6de581e937301d8552cb44489cdff035c6187cb63fa5e
 SIZE (rust/crates/ws2_32-sys-0.2.1.tar.gz) = 4697
-SHA256 (canop-broot-v0.13.4_GH0.tar.gz) = fd9af3df87f61dbce01c262c71d07cd11221602da7662c321501772eb9a68fff
-SIZE (canop-broot-v0.13.4_GH0.tar.gz) = 1681328
+SHA256 (canop-broot-v0.13.5b_GH0.tar.gz) = 8a37d66a30f15c64db5ffeded1f2b6d808bd80261d7e8d97e6288cfd1db621dd
+SIZE (canop-broot-v0.13.5b_GH0.tar.gz) = 2090397


More information about the svn-ports-all mailing list